Universal Soldier: Regeneration Fun Facts
Universal Soldier: Regeneration features a unique fight scene where Jean-Claude Van Damme and Dolph Lundgren, both iconic action stars, face off against each other for the first time since the original Universal Soldier film in 1992.
The film was shot in various locations in Eastern Europe, including the Ukraine, which provided a gritty backdrop that enhanced the movie's militaristic themes.
